I. The Pre-Motherhood Rebel Wilson: A Trajectory of Success

Rebel Wilson's rise to fame was nothing short of remarkable. From her early comedic roles in Australian television to her breakout performance in Bridesmaids, she quickly established herself as a versatile and charismatic actress. Her signature brand of self-deprecating humor resonated with audiences, leading to starring roles in successful films like Pitch Perfect, Isn't It Romantic, and Jojo Rabbit. These roles solidified her position as a bankable star, proving her ability to carry films and attract a wide demographic. Her commercial success wasn't solely confined to the big screen; she also secured lucrative endorsement deals and showcased her entrepreneurial spirit through various ventures.
